Dongfeng Motor Group’s EV brand Voyah raises $639m at over $4b valuation

Voyah, a premium electric vehicle brand under China’s auto giant Dongfeng Motor Group has notched 4.55 billion yuan ($638.5 million) in a Series A round, Chinese financial media outlet Yicai reported on Thursday.  The round has brought the company’s valuation to 29.5 billion yuan ($4.1 billion), per the report. Clean Technica: Global Electric Vehicle Sales Up 62% (Overall Auto Sales Down 8%)002379

Electric vehicle sales were up 62% globally in the first half of 2022 compared to the first half of 2021. That includes fully electric vehicles and plugin hybrids. These plugin vehicles reached 4.3 million sales in the first half of 2022, according to global EV analysis leaders at EV-Volumes.
